Three Fish was an American rock band formed in 1994 by Pearl Jam's Jeff Ament.
[1] David Fricke of Rolling Stone said, "The whole thing is a weird mix – folky self-obsession, crackling pop, heavy, metallic sighing – but Three Fish is definitely worth, in the words of one song, 'a lovely meander.
'"[2] The band reformed and on June 1, 1999, released its second album, The Quiet Table.
Stephen Thomas Erlewine of Allmusic said that "while it can seem a little turgid at times, it's an ambitious project that often pays off in intriguing songs and evocative sonic textures.
